Post by terry2stoke on Feb 11, 2008 19:06:41 GMT
From Waford Junction to Watford FC's Vicarage Road Leave the station & take main road straight opposite (Clarendon Road) all the way (over Ring Road at lights) up to the High Street. Turn left and go past past Wetherspoons (Moon under Water) on your right and then take the first right after 100 yards into Market Street. Continue along again crossing Ring Road to T junction & then left at an excellent chip shop. Vicarage Road is the next right turn. Should take around 15-20 minutes to walk.

Her hum... Ilford - its 'our' Manor ;D
Watford Junction is about 25 mins walk through the town, past the pubs & shops in the high street and on to Vicarage Road.
Watford High Street is a 10 minute walk from the ground and is at the bottom of the high street.
Tube is about the same as Watford Junction.
If I was coming down from Stoke - Virgin Trains Stoke to Watford Junction is the best by far. From London - Euston to Watford High Street. Forget the tube it takes a bloody eternity!
